Follow the steps to successfully complete the CALL 1 form online.
- Click the ‘Get Form’ button to access the form and open it in an online editor.
- Begin by reviewing Section 1, which requests the reason for submitting the form. Check the applicable box(es) for new registration, additional registration, or other relevant reasons.
- Proceed to complete Section 2, where you will select the type of business entity. Check the box that corresponds to your entity type such as sole proprietorship, corporation, or partnership.
- Fill out Section 3 with detailed business information, including the legal name, street address (avoid P.O. boxes), telephone number, and email address.
- In Section 4, provide your federal employer identification number, the date of first operation, and specify your accounting method and fiscal year end.
- Complete Section 5 by filling in ownership and relationship details, and ensure to check the appropriate boxes that indicate roles such as owner or partner.
- In Section 6, check the relevant business activity type, such as retail or manufacturing, and provide any associated percentages.
- Fill out Section 7 regarding withholding information. Indicate if your business will have employees and provide details about payroll tax responsibilities.
- Review Section 8 where an authorized signature is required. Include your title, date, and contact information.
- Finally, make sure to save your changes, then download, print, or share the completed form as needed.
